Ok so here's the scoop.long version.
We were late coming back to Cabo on Friday. We did the ATV tour ( which was UNBELIEVABE! ) . The tour was suppose to start at 8:40 am. With the time change, I didn't figure it out right, and we would Have been an hour late back to the tender. We pleaded with the tour company, and they were amazing! They gave the 9 of us a private tour, ( which was so great as there was a lot of 20 something guys that appeared to be drunk.... At 9:00 am! ) they took us back to the tender just in time, a little after one. There appeared to be a long tender line (past the bar ) and everyone in our party needed a washroom break. So off we went. Gone for about 10 min. When we returned the Disney line was empty and closed off with a garbage can! Running with my family, we just made it on the last tender. There was only a young family ( dad, mom and son about 2) on board as well as the Disney crew who were working at the terminal. The father was asking them to wait for the rest of his family( mother, father, brother ect.) and Disney said "no we are late and the we need to leave." He JUMPED OFF THE BOAT just before the last crew member got on. He was holding up his hands saying wait! Wait! And ran back into the terminal.
The boat left! The women stared screaming and they just kept going. He had all her ID and everything. It was awful. When we got to the boat, the anchor was already up, as it was now almost 1:40pm. She was so upset and security came and escorted her through and she was gone. I heard them paging a family from deck 2. The boat left, and that was it.
That night, I asked CS what happened to her husband, and they said they didn't know. I figured they didn't want to share personal info with me. I was so worried about her. They also said ( and this was Friday night) that we would now be late arriving back to the terminal on Sunday. It is very different then trying to get back to Port Canaveral from the Bahamas. There us no waiting.
They said that it happens quite often, and people need to pay attention to the warnings. That sooooo could have been us. Between the brutal flight cancellation coming in to LA on Sat., missing the bus for the Zipline tour on Wednesday, and then this on friday, we were mentally exhausted.
